In the city of Kano, Dorayi Tinga neighborhood, around four in the afternoon on a Thursday, there stood a modest house, part of a row of small homes. At first glance, you could tell the residents were of limited means—by the appearance of the walls, the rope fences, the lack of proper drainage, and the poorly maintained roads. Everyone’s home faced outward, and each person displayed what they could of their property; some had repairs, others didn’t. The small houses seemed to lean against one another as if one might climb onto the next.

“Are you not going to come and do the errand for me, or must the charcoal finish first?” asked a young matron, seated on a low stool, holding a pestle and grinding maize flour. Beside her, a silver plate carried a heap of cornmeal dough.

A girl emerged from a room behind the woman, holding her hijab in one hand while wiping tears with the other.

The woman looked at her sharply. “Why are you crying?”

The girl hesitated, as though unsure how to answer, then said softly, “It’s not Huzaifa…”

“Be quiet! That’s all you know how to say, as if your cries can stop what’s happening. If I forbid you from going where he is, will you disobey? Take this money and go to Laure’s house. Sixty [coins] for the soup, forty for the palm oil, and bring back the change. Hurry, or I’ll cook the meal without you.”

The girl pulled a face. “So today, soup too? Inna lillahi wa inna ilaihi raji’un…”

The woman didn’t open her mouth, just watched her with a stern gaze. “When I give orders, don’t argue. Take the money and leave, or shall I deal with you here?”

The girl knelt, took the money, adjusted her hijab, and headed out, thinking to herself that with this maize dough, they’d hardly have a decent meal for the day.

The woman, warning her, said, “If you find the chance, sit down for a moment, but don’t rush. Watch how I handle you, or how you behave with the children on the way.”

Without any fuss, the girl continued, glancing around as she went.

At her friend Habiba’s house, she found Habiba’s mother in the courtyard, braiding hair. She knelt to greet her, then asked where Habiba was.

Habiba appeared from inside, smiling at her. She came over and asked, “Ruma, where are you headed?”

In a soft, pleading voice, Ruma replied, “Please, Habiba, can I borrow Sani’s help? My mother sent me; I want to hurry there and come back quickly.”

Habiba frowned. “Ruma, you know Sani is too much for you. I won’t let you go and waste your time. It’s the three of us now—you, me, and him.”

Ruma, confident, said, “I swear she won’t waste my time. Just let me go; I’ll hurry and come back.”

Habiba guided Ruma toward their house, looking toward the small chicken coop in the little enclosed courtyard. She handed Ruma Sani’s young rooster and said, “Please, Ruma, be careful with this bird. Make sure nothing happens to it. Go quickly and come back soon.”

Ruma smiled. “Don’t worry. I’ll go, handle it, and return. I want this little rooster to know I can handle it. Now you’ll see me go and come back safely.”

Habiba smiled. “Alright then. Hurry before he comes back.”
